cron 学习笔记

cron linux下运行计划任务的服务器,根据配置文件约定的时间来执行特定的任务。

cron (ubuntu)

启动服务 service cron start

关闭服务 service cron stop

重启服务 service cron restart

重新载入配置 service cron reload


配置cron的两种方法:

1、使用crontab命令

-u是指定用户

-e编辑用户的cron服务

-l列出用户的cron服务

-r删除用户的cron服务

如:crontab -u root -e 编辑root用户的cron任务

进入编辑模式后

显示:# m h dom mon dow command

m指分钟(0-59)

h指小时(0-23)

dom指日期(1-31)

mon指月份(1-12)

dow指星期(0-6)0为星期天

比如:

30 16 * * * echo “Take care of yourself!” > /dev/null

四点30分 执行命令 echo “Take care of yourself!”


2、修改/etc/crontab文件

vim 显示为

# m h dom mon dow user command

user 指定用户

如:01 * * * * root run-parts /etc/cron.hourly

每小时执行/etc/cron.hourly内的脚本

run-parts 指执行文件夹内的脚本

去掉run-parts可直接加 脚本命令

其它同第一种方式。


评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值